32 George Street is a charming 1910 cottage situated on an level 235m2 allotment. The home has been lovingly restored by the current owners with a substantial renovation and extension completed in 2006, unlocking its Easterly aspect at the rear of the home.
The home blends old and new effortlessly juxtaposing original character features on entry to the seamless open plan extension at the rear.
Positioned quietly behind a picket fence and retaining its original verandah, the double brick cottage offers immediate street appeal.
The original part of the home showcases original cornices, picture railings, architraves and ceiling roses that have been carefully restored throughout. The three bedrooms are located upon entry, with the master bedroom on the right enjoying a built-in wardrobe.
The extension is set on polished concrete floors with underfloor heating. Glass stacker doors provide an open entry into a private entertaining area capturing the morning sun. The kitchen is finished with high quality appliances, stainless steel bench tops, gas cooking and soft close cabinetry.
The light-filled bathroom is generous in size with a walk-in shower, gas hot water and North facing skylight. The home stays comfortable year-round through its variety of heating options from Air Well air conditioning system, Devi underfloor heating, wood fire and panel heaters.
32 George Street features additional attic storage areas in the ceiling and underfloor. The home has off-street parking for one car leading to an easily maintained grassed area with lemon tree on the Northern side of the home adjoining a timber deck. The outhouse at the rear of the home contains the laundry and separate toilet. The property is securely fenced, ideal for a pet.
Situated just one block back from the popular North Hobart strip, 32 George Street is within walking distance to popular cafs and restaurants and a gentle walk to Hobart CBD.

The size of North Hobart is approximately 1.0 square kilometres. There are 3 parks, covering nearly 5.6% of the total area. The population of North Hobart in 2016 was 2494 people. By 2021 the population was 2600 showing a population growth of 4.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in North Hobart is 20-29 years. Households in North Hobart are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in North Hobart work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 43.80% of the homes in North Hobart were owner-occupied compared with 41.80% in 2016.
